Why is this needed: Using repeat panel option can't be the solution because it just dynamically creates new panels. Navigate to the dashboard that you want to make a variable for, and then choose the Dashboard settings (gear) icon at the top of the page. I am trying to use variables in transformations, the Graphite Template Nested example on Use grafana variable only for panel in metric queries and in panel titles use variables in,! All records belonging to the panel have the value in this field and match the panel variable. P.S. Additional helpful documentation, links, and articles: Opening keynote: What's new in Grafana 9? To delete a threshold, navigate to the panel that contains the threshold and click the trash icon next to the threshold you want to remove. So then if theres 1 line in a graph its going to be red. How do I configure grafana to use Oauth2 when it's behind an Application Load Balancer? By clicking post your Answer, you agree to our terms of service, privacy policy and cookie.. To create a new variable, go to your Grafana dashboard settings, navigate to the Variable option in the side-menu, and then click the Add variable button. Im going to use the example of visualizing the real-time location in New York City, using data from the Metropolitan Transportation Authority. And share knowledge within a single location that is structured and easy search. Or worse, stakeholders try to dig into the code and accidentally break things! This would be preferable to a hack to allow template variables to work with alerting since it prevents the possibility of a user from removing hosts from a template selection and thus disabling alerting. For example in below pic, I want min with 16.3 to show in red. I'm thinking we would need a way to specify the column to interpret against the thresholds for each row when going to render as #27542 (comment) said. The query that we use in the grafana table panel is: x509_cert_expiry{host=~"$host"}. However, I want the range based on individual columns. Values can be text or numeric. Use Grafana to turn failure into resilience. It will bring up a color selection diagram. How to show that an expression of a finite type must be one of the finitely many possible values? In case you are embedding Grafana's dashboard/panel, check for "allow_embedding = true" under "[security]" section in grafana.ini and use &kiosk parameter in a URL to avoid menus. Heres what my panel looks like before we make it interactive. Producing temperature data into MySQL db dashboard allows us to pull all the together! The difference between the phonemes /p/ and /b/ in Japanese, How to handle a hobby that makes income in US, Partner is not responding when their writing is needed in European project application. Calculating probabilities from d6 dice pool (Degenesis rules for botches and triggers). Opinions expressed by DZone contributors are their own. Thanks for creating this issue! Variables dynamically change your queries across all panels in a dashboard. Have a question about this project? For a SQL query, we do this by modifying the WHERE clause to filter out undesirable results. You can control the background or value color using thresholds or color scales. I should be able to set 0 = green 1 = yellow 2 = red. Design / logo 2022 Stack exchange Inc ; user contributions licensed under BY-SA. You can write some code yourself that uses the HTTP api to sync template variables across many dashboards raleigh county housing authority. For example in below pic, I want min with 16.3 to show in red, grafana Share Follow asked Mar 8, 2022 at 7:48 Selva 821 5 18 Color scheme (for v7.3+) - this makes it easier to set specific single colors with overrides, from thresholds, and makes it easier to create color palettes: Powered by Discourse, best viewed with JavaScript enabled, How to set the color of drawings (line or bar), http://docs.grafana.org/features/panels/graph/. This post gives you step-by-step demos and shows you how to create 6 different visuals for DevOps, IoT, geospatial, and public data use cases (and beyond), as well as answers to common questions about building visuals in Grafana. If you change it to . @grant2 yep, that does clarify things for me, thank you! How do i enable Prometheus/Grafana to show my rabbitmq metrics ? Edfinancial Services Phone Number, I would upvote this FR and add your perspective to the thread: Due to the limitation of not being able to utilize template variables with alerting, it would be very useful to allow for variable declaration within individual panels. In the rest of this post, I will show you how to use Grafanas variables feature to build your own interactive dashboards. It seems like it's not implemented yet, as you can see on this open issue from 2018. Not the answer you're looking for? Accommodation Cambridge, Uk, The color choice popup happens, but clicks are ignored. unknown email address on iphone cuisinart chef's classic cookware set, Godziny pracy: Find centralized, trusted content and collaborate around the technologies you use most. Note: Repeating panels require variables to have one or more items selected; you cannot repeat a panel zero times to hide it. Select a category variable (field) and let users set colors for each value and colorize whole row. 3. Dashboard variables aren't useful for this, because you'd like to set each panel independently, and it would result in an unmanageable and confusing number of similarly-named variables. Over 2 million developers have joined DZone. 10. Is a PhD visitor considered as a visiting scholar? Why is this sentence from The Great Gatsby grammatical? Scheme: A color gradient defined by your Color scheme. It currently shows no data. I want to change the color of the annotation bar based on tags added to that annotation. Enter this under "Custom Style / CSS Override". But when I select one and change it to another color and save the graph, it changes back to green for any other server. Dashboard settings are hidden behind the gear icon While the standard static panel tells us the live location of the buses, theres not much that we can do to interact and explore the data more, apart from zooming in and out. Having this feature of applying 'Cell Display Mode' to an entire row based on the threshold value of one cell will be very helpful. Found this tutorial useful? 4. Use Grafana to turn failure into resilience. On the display options pane, click Panel options > Repeat options. # x27 ; t find any way related recommendations ; never saint cheat.! 2 = (blue) Color Text - Head TAble codlord March 31, 2021, 1:31pm 2 Not natively. How to handle a hobby that makes income in US. I think table panel is very important yet very limited compared to other features grafana provides. Connect and share knowledge within a single location that is structured and easy to search. Select "Boom Plugin". Finally, I also see that _variables.dark.generated.scss tells you to Edit grafana-ui/src/themes/_variables.dark.scss.tmpl.ts to update template, however I cannot find that file either. However, after the upgrade to v7.4.0, we are now seeing that the entire column defaults to red. To select some `` Categories '' can use variables in metric queries and in panel.. Where clause to filter this table to only show the relevant data for the have! You can download the JSON to replicate the dashboard in this Github repo. More information in the Grafana docs: https://grafana.com/docs/reference/templating/. A Grafana panel is the user interface you use to define a data source query, and transform and format data that appears in visualizations. Follow Up: struct sockaddr storage initialization by network format-string. A Tour of the Grafana Interface. There are some situations where dashboard-level variables simply do not provide the granularity needed to convey information in the most efficient way. efda February 8, 2021, 2:39pm #4 Hello. Prometheus dashboard with repeating panels. Just a suggestion off of this topic: Thanks for contributing an answer to Stack Overflow! 2022-11-09 . Like before we make it interactive learn how to visualize geo-spatial data using World. FROM mydb To illustrate, below is my dashboard with 2 panels and 3 variables that I configured. Open the dashboard that contains the panel. Banded rows would be nice for big tables, and I might find uses for color-per-value. I think this may be a bug. *' to hide the rest - a very important feature that seems to also have been removed. OK, I couldnt figure out what the answer is. I have a grafana table which shows max, min, avg and std.dev. A common problem Ive run into (both when creating dashboards and using them as a stakeholder) is that many dashboards arent interactive enough for non-technical stakeholders to get their questions answered without asking engineers to write new code or change the underlying queries powering the dashboard. Well demo all the highlights of the major release: new and updated visualizations and themes, data source improvements, and Enterprise features. You can do that with the Overrides panel. You can add more visualization types by installing panel panel plugins. However, if you want the mapping from key to values, in order to express both symbols and human readable names, an SQL query is required. Email update@grafana.com for help. Another user needs to edit the same Text panel, and click on "Markdown" or "HTML" for the code to . These are variables coming from the Grafana server as dropdown lists at the bottom under `` preview of what resulting. The colors for each type are close enough you can get a good representation of how the pool is doing on cpu overall, but they are different enough that you can also tell if one host or cpu is struggling . 1995 Ethiopian Constitution Pdf, Find centralized, trusted content and collaborate around the technologies you use most. Why are physically impossible and logically impossible concepts considered separate in terms of probability? The text was updated successfully, but these errors were encountered: would love to see banded rows, currently one of our biggest reasons for not switching to grafana from other solutions, need very readable dashboards. Is it suspicious or odd to stand by the gate of a GA airport watching the planes? I havent seen anything about this, but it would be neat to be able to set default colors for the dashboard in dashboard settings. Well demo all the highlights of the major release: new and updated visualizations and themes, data source improvements, and Enterprise features. On visualizations that support it, Grafana sets default threshold values of: The Base value represents minus infinity. Thank you so much! Why do many companies reject expired SSL certificates as bugs in bug bounties? Metropolitan Transportation Authority have models other than the natural numbers, why is this ok kiosk mode variables! Could you point me in the right direction, please? Thats it! grafana/influxdb display ratio of two fields Ask Question -1 I have a timeseries measurement stored in influxdb where one column represents the sum and the other represents the count, I want to divide these two columns and plot their ratio in grafana.